Synonym discussion
Sense: noun/1
Fluorescence, luminescence, phosphorescence, and bioluminescence all describe the emission of light from a substance, but they differ in mechanism and duration. Luminescence is the broadest category — any emission of cold light that is not caused by heat. Fluorescence is a specific type of luminescence in which the glow stops almost instantly (within nanoseconds) when the energy source is removed; it typically involves ultraviolet light being converted into visible light. Phosphorescence is similar, but the material stores the energy and releases it slowly, so the glow can continue for seconds or even hours after the source is turned off. Bioluminescence is a special case in which light is produced through a chemical reaction inside a living organism, such as a firefly or a deep-sea fish. For example, the bright mark on a fluorescent highlighter fades the moment you remove the UV light (fluorescence), whereas the glow-in-the-dark stars on a bedroom ceiling keep shining for a while (phosphorescence).

Etymology
The word comes from the mineral fluorite (calcium fluoride), which was one of the first substances in which the effect was observed. The mineral's name comes from Latin 'fluere' (to flow), referring to its use as a flux in metal smelting. The suffix '-escence' means 'a process or state of becoming'. The term 'fluorescence' was coined by Irish physicist Sir George Stokes in 1852.
